Output 43890643383f16c987b2eeaa806e6dce4835413c1da49214c5225b853981b18b:8

value
696390
script pubkey
OP_0 OP_PUSHBYTES_20 627c59e11aea9d26c15b9f41473ce304d3805717
address
bc1qvf79ncg6a2wjds2mnaq5w08rqnfcq4chhns053
transaction
43890643383f16c987b2eeaa806e6dce4835413c1da49214c5225b853981b18b
confirmations
195604
spent
true